Energy calculated at B3LYP/6-31G**
 hartrees
Energy at 0K-724.227948
Energy at 298.15K-724.231776
Nuclear repulsion energy284.230149
The energy at 298.15K was derived from the energy at 0K and an integrated heat capacity that used the calculated vibrational frequencies.
